Mission

The USATF Foundation provides a means to attract and guide funds to new and innovative track and field programs with an emphasis on providing opportunities for youth athletes, emerging elite athletes, and distance training centers. The foundation depends upon donations from its board of directors, major gifts, and from generous fans of track & field. Elite athletes are supported by the foundation via monetary grants and participation in Run With US! Youth athletes are supported via monetary grants to youth clubs.

About

Elite athlete programs: contribute to the pursuit of world-class performance through grants to 70 plus athletes meeting performance, income and other criteria. Also include grant(s) to support elite athlete coaching.
